Resort-based points programs are also offered as deeded and as right to utilize. Points programs annually give the owner a number of points equal to the level of ownership. The owner in a points program can then utilize these indicate make travel plans within the resort group. Many points programs are connected with big resort groups offering a big selection of choices for destination.
Resort point program members, such as WorldMark by Wyndham and Diamond Resorts International, might ask for from the whole available inventory of the resort group. A points program member may frequently request fractional weeks in addition to full or numerous week stays. The variety of points required to remain at the resort in concern will vary based on a points chart.

System size affects the cost and demand at any given resort. The same does not be true comparing resorts in various places. A one-bedroom system in a preferable location may still be more expensive and in higher demand than a two-bedroom lodging in a resort with less demand. An example of this may be a one-bedroom at a desirable beach resort compared to a two-bedroom system at a resort situated inland from the very same beach.

Timeshare sales are typically high-pressure and fast-moving affairs. Some individuals get captured up in the enjoyment of the sales discussion and sign a contract, just to recognize later that they might have slipped up.
Federal Trade Commission mandates a "cool down duration" that enables people to cancel some kinds of purchases without charge within 3 days. Additionally, almost all U.S. states have laws that particularly govern cancellation of timeshare agreements. In Florida, a new timeshare owner can cancel the purchase within 10 days. The law differs by jurisdiction regarding whether out-of-state buyers are subject to the rescission period of their state of residence, or the rescission period of the state where the timeshare purchase was made (e.
Another typical practice is to have the prospective buyer indication a "cancellation waiver", utilizing it as a reason to reduce the rate of the timeshare in exchange for the buyer waiving cancellation rights (or paying a charge, such as losing 10% of the purchase rate, if the sale is cancelled).
If a recent timeshare buyer wants to rescind or cancel the timeshare contract, the intent to cancel need to be made within the allocated period in writing or face to face; a phone call will not be adequate - how to get rid of timeshare without ruining credit. It is more than most likely that a new timeshare owner could have purchased the same check here product from an existing owner on the timeshare resale market for considerably less than what the buyer paid from the resort designer, just by doing a computer search. Oftentimes, the exact or similar lodging purchased, will be happily transferred by an unhappy timeshare owner.
The reason for this anomaly is that the lion's share of the cost of a brand-new timeshare are sales commissions and marketing overhead, and can not be retrieved by the timeshare owner. Another reason a new owner might wish to cancel is purchaser's remorse following the subsidence of enjoyment produced by a sales discussion.
